History

Early History

An ancient bronze artifact from the Early Bronze Age of Ethan Smith
The first people of the Great Land of Ethan Smith were from around the Early Bronze Age or around 2000 B.C. Archaeologists found that the earliest people were an agricultural society with some signs of metalworking with tin and copper. Bronze vessels used for rituals, farming instruments, and weapons were uncovered in recent archaeological digs. The famous Cornith Carvings in the Cornith Caves at the foothills of the Greater Chomla Mountains showed that these early people had their own writing. It still remains undeciphered to this day. Villages along the eastern coast of the Gulf of Magalenia near the town of Najamash, dating back to 1500 B.C., show evidence of early trading of bronze items with other early civilizations of the time.

Settlements from about 3000 years ago along the Aorata River and the Long River were heavily defended forts atop the rolling hills of the southern part of the nation. Each one had kings that ruled the walled part of the city along with the surrounding landscape. There were many coups and overturning of the leaders back then causing much turmoil for centuries. Around the 1st century B.C., the Chells people sprung up and annihilated the neighboring states eventually absorbing every other state in the vicinity. Wangi, the king at the time, managed to unite the Great Land of Ethan Smith. He installed a centralized government, a single currency, and a standardized measurement system. Most importantly, he unified the language to create a standard language for easier business and education. Because of these advances, the people of the Great Land of Ethan Smith still refer to themselves as the sons or daughters of Wangi. Although he brought along concepts that still are in effect in today's nation, he also brought many negative points. He ordered all he books that opposed his ideas to be burned. All the scholars that disagreed with his style of government were buried alive. Sixteen years after he became the ruler of a united Ethan Smith, Wangi died of mercury poisoning. The culprit was the disgruntled Officer of the King's Stables, Barlow. He put a lethal amount of mercury in Wangi's food. This put the Great Land of Ethan Smith back into chaos for another century.

Modern History

The first century A.D. were a time of reform for Ethan Smith. A new leader, Nizu, increased trade with neighboring states and improved the arts and literature. Ocean navigation was at its peak and riches from distant lands were brought to the nation. The arts were encouraged at this time which created master artwork only found in fancy-schmancy museums today. Many classic novels were also written at this time. The technological advancements were phenomenal. Boats were built stronger to sustain the growing navy. Medicine modernized greatly too, which sparked a jump in the population. The capital at the time, Cornith was booming. It was the center of trade and the arts for Ethan Smith and the surround region. This prosperity last for almost a millennium. To most people in Ethan Smith now, this is considered a time of enlightenment.

A picture of modern-day Lahoyia Beach
In the year 985 A.D., invading barbarians spread through the land causing widespread panic. They arrived by boat at Lahoyia Beach in the southeastern area of the nation and transmitted foreign diseases. The population declined rapidly and some people were enslaved by the conquering nation. They then colonized Ethan Smith and turning Ethan Smith into pandemonium once again. The capital, Cornith was sacked and moved to the newly built Martinos. After a century of brutal ruling, there was an uprising commonly know today as the Lahoyia Uprising, named after the famous general, Lahoyia Ponchbart that led armies of rookie soldiers across the Greater Chomla Mountains from the fertile banks of the Ekana River to the beach where the uprising started. The farmers grew tired of the unfair power and decided to revolt. Many lives were lost and upset the nation once more. After years of severe fighting, the farmers of Ethan Smith won. The barbarians finally left and the current Great Land of Ethan Smith was formed.

The last 1000 years has been beneficial for Ethan Smith. Urbanization became the norm as many people moved to the city. The city of Ethania grew to become the capital of Ethan Smith. The people started to cultivate the sparsely populated west of the country. This created a boom in not only the economy and trade but also the population. During the 1300 and 1400s, ships were sent to improve diplomacy and help Ethan Smith have a greater impact in the world. In turn many other nations sent tributes to the Great Land of Ethan Smith. Revivals in religion were common in the 1500s. Industrialization in the 17th, 18th and 19th centuries spurred the economy. New technology in mining and farming decreased the prices of minerals and ores and also crops and livestock for Ethan Smith. Today Ethan Smith is one of the most advanced nations in the world.

Government

The Great Land of Ethan Smith consists of a Head of State and other government officials, which is elected by the people. Although they are the leaders, they must abide to the Constitution of Ethan Smith. The government of this nation is divided into three groups: Executive, Legislative, and Judicial. All of which have equal power.

The Executive Branch

The Presidential Palace of the Great Land of Ethan Smith
The executive branch is manages the the Great Land of Ethan Smith. Although he manages the nation, he is not allowed to make laws (the job of the legislative branch), nor to interpret them (the job of the judicial branch). In the Great Land of Ethan Smith, the leader, called the president, is the Head of Government and the Head of State. Along with the president, he or she is also aided by several ministers assigned to different subjects (ex. defense, health, etc.) The executive branch consists of the president, Ethan Smith. He currently resides in Ethania where the Presidential Palace is. There are no political parties in the Great Land of Ethan Smith, so the president isn't affiliated with a political party.

The Legislative Branch

The dome of the Legislative Council Building which houses both the Senate and the House of Representatives
The legislative branch consists of the House of Representatives and the Senate. There are sixteen counties ruled by each of the sixteen cities in Ethan Smith. In the House of Representatives, Each county is represented proportionately according to each county's population. The representatives are elected by the people for two-year terms. The current number of seats is 112, although this number can change due to the rising immigration rate. In the Senate, each county is represented by two people, making the total number of seats in the Senate thirty-two. Each senator serves for four-year terms, but the terms are staggered. Every year, one-fourth of the senators step down so that the leader, called the general, of each of the ex-senator's county can appoint new senators. The two halves of the legislative branch serve to balance the power between themselves.

The Judicial Branch

The judicial branch is basically the court system of Ethan Smith. It resolves disputes and finds out what is lawful and what is illegal. The judicial branch interprets the law for the case being brought up, but it is forbidden for the judicial branch to create the law. Each court uses the Constitution of Ethan Smith as the starting point of interpreting law. Each county in Ethan Smith has a court. If the county court is not able to to close a case, then it is brought up to the Supreme Court, in Ethania.

Geography

Map of the Great Land of Ethan Smith
The geography of the Great Land of Ethan Smith is very diverse. In the east, the Chomla Range stretches from north to south along the coast, leaving a small coastal plain rich in agriculture. Kamike Island is on the eastern coast of Ethan Smith. As you move south, the landscape includes the mighty Wakin River, the oldest river in Ethan Smith. At the southern tip, the island of Koromas sits with a bright lighthouse warning of the turbulent waters around the island. The northwestern part of the nation is relatively flat with sparsely located hills. The Ashpin Forest lies in this area. This region is also fertile. The southwest peninsula includes the Marrock Mountains, and Komburland Island is on the eastern side of the peninsula.

Rivers

There are several rivers in Ethan Smith. The most vital is the Long River. Ethan Smith's earliest civilization started along the river. It starts out from Ferreiro Lake in the north of the nation and runs in a winding path mainly going from east until it runs into the Chachtee River. At the intersection, both rivers run south into the Gulf of Magalenia. The Chachtee River's headwaters are in the Marrock Mountains. It travels northward for most of its length, then makes a u-turn southward until it merges with the Long River. The Aorata River starts in the Greater Chomla Range and runs in a westerly direction until it reaches the Long River. The Wakin River starts near the Aorata River but runs south. It winds through the countryside making many leisurely hairpin turns until it empties into the ocean. The Ekāna River runs southeast from Ferreiro Lake down to the ocean. Because this river carries so much silt, it provides fertile farming area for the area. Kamike Island is an alluvial island caused by the silt carried from the river. This island is home to the most pristine wildlife in Ethan Smith.

Mountains

One of the mountains in the Marrock Mountains
There are two main mountain ranges in the Great Land of Ethan Smith. On the eastern coast lies the Chomla Range, while on the southwestern tip is the Marrock Mountains. The Chomla Range was formed by two tectonic plates pressing on the other causing the land to rise from the sea. Most of the Chomla Range was completely underwater thousands of years ago. The Marrock Mountains aren't mountains, but volcanoes. Most are extinct, but a few are active. They are mostly harmless because of the slow-moving lava flows. Although the city of Itadaki lies in the foothills of the Marrock Mountains, it rarely receives major damage.
